The Waiho Suite
Welcome to the Waiho Suite, your spacious home away from home nestled at the base of the majestic West Coast mountains, surrounded by rainforest, sprawling farmland and vibrant native gardens you can roam. The Waiho Suite offers exclusive use of the entire top floor of Ribbonwood Retreat, boasting views of stunning Westland National Park vistas that travel as far as the eye can see, inviting you to truly let go, relax and let nature envelop you.
The Wahio Suite encompasses two bedrooms of which both have ranch slider doors that open out onto private decks, perfectly positioned to watch twilight drop her curtain every day. Soak up the colour palette of our famous West Coast sunsets whilst enjoying your favourite beverage and appreciating the vastness around you that is UNESCO World Heritage. The master bedroom is a whopping 35 square metres complete with a comfortable king bed and a single bed with direct views of the glaciers and the mountains. There is also a workspace, walk-in wardrobe and sofa.
The second bedroom offers 12 square metres of comfort, has a queen bed and shares a generous bathroom with the master room. There is no guest kitchen however drink making facilities are always available and Ribbonwood has several excellent restaurants nearby, offering complimentary transport.
This includes a fully cooked breakfast fresh from our garden.
Due to safety concerns with the stairs and balcony, the Waiho Rooms are not suitable for children under the age of 7. Instead, we recommend booking The Cottage if you are travelling with children.
